What problem does it solve?

Orchestrates multi-agent swarms to coordinate complex, parallel workstreams across teams and tools, enabling scalable collaboration.

Core Features & Use Cases

  • TeammateTool-driven team orchestration including leaders, teammates, tasks, and inbox messaging.
  • Supports parallel specialists, sequential pipelines, swarm-based processing, and plan-driven workflows.
  • Applicable to code reviews, feature pipelines, refactoring efforts, and large-scale collaborative initiatives with dependency management.
